Brandicus, I just installed these on my car a few days ago....it comes with 4 resistors...all u have to do is remove the old taillights and trunk lights, remove the harness from the old and plug into the new and plug back into the car...each taillight and trunk light has a connection for a resistor so you will hook up a resistor to each tail and trunk light...it took sometime but was pretty easy to do...and NO SPLICING whatsoever its all plug n play, good luck!
